An exciting opportunity to join a fast growing, performance led digital agency working with global brands in the Events, Music and Festival space. This is a newly created role designed to support the next stage of growth. The business is looking for someone genuinely obsessed with AI, automation and systems, who is constantly testing new tools and thinking about how work can be done smarter and faster. You will work closely with senior leadership to improve how the agency operates, starting with Paid Media but expanding across Creative, Strategy, Sales and Operations. The focus is on reducing manual work, improving data visibility and building scalable processes that allow the business to grow without unnecessary complexity. This role will suit someone who enjoys building, experimenting and implementing, rather than simply managing existing processes.

The agency is looking for a hands on AI Operations Manager to audit current workflows, identify opportunities and introduce AI driven solutions that improve speed, accuracy and output across the business. You will be responsible for testing, implementing and embedding smarter ways of working, with a strong focus on measurable efficiency and real impact.

Key Responsibilities
  • AI & Automation
    • Continuously explore emerging AI and automation tools
    • Test and implement solutions that improve operational efficiency
    • Build automation across reporting, internal processes and selected client workflows
    • Run structured pilots, measure outcomes and scale what works
    • Maintain a clear backlog of experiments and ideas
  • Systems & Workflow Optimisation
    • Audit existing workflows across Paid Media, Creative, Strategy, Sales and Operations
    • Map the current technology stack and identify inefficiencies or duplication
    • Implement improvements aligned with leadership priorities
    • Support standardisation of core tools and processes
  • Cross Functional Integration
    • Work closely with department leads to improve handovers, collaboration and data flow
    • Ensure CRM, reporting, finance and delivery systems are connected
    • Support teams in refining and scaling their own efficiency initiatives
  • Documentation & Adoption
    • Document processes in a clear and simple way
    • Create internal training and guidance
    • Ensure new systems are embedded and adopted
  • Commercial Impact
    • Track time saved and operational capacity created
    • Demonstrate the impact of improved systems on delivery and margin
    • Provide leadership with visibility on progress and outcomes
Experience & Skills
  • Experience within a marketing agency or performance led digital business
  • Strong understanding of how agencies operate
  • Hands on experience with workflow systems, CRM optimisation or automation
  • Comfortable working with tools such as HubSpot, N8N, Claude or similar
  • Passion for AI and curiosity about new technologies
  • Working knowledge of scripting or coding is beneficial but not essential
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ills
  • Comfortable working in a founder led, fast paced environment
